12345678910111213141516171819202122232425262728293031323334353637383940414243 |
- <?php
- namespace App\Http\Controllers\Channel\OfficialAccount\Transformers;
- class WechatTemplatesMsgTransformer
- {
- public function transform($wechatTemplatesMsg){
- return [
- 'id' => $wechatTemplatesMsg->id,
- 'template_id' => $wechatTemplatesMsg->template_id,
- 'name' => $wechatTemplatesMsg->name,
- 'send_time' => $wechatTemplatesMsg->send_time,
- 'template_content' => $wechatTemplatesMsg->template_content,
- 'redirect_url' => $wechatTemplatesMsg->redirect_url,
- 'appid' => $wechatTemplatesMsg->appid,
- 'status' => $wechatTemplatesMsg->status,
- 'remark' => $wechatTemplatesMsg->remark,
- 'distribution_channel_id' => $wechatTemplatesMsg->distribution_channel_id,
- 'common_template_id' => $wechatTemplatesMsg->wechatTemplates->wechatPublicTemplates->common_template_id,
- 'title' => $wechatTemplatesMsg->wechatTemplates->wechatPublicTemplates->title,
- 'primary_industry' => $wechatTemplatesMsg->wechatTemplates->wechatPublicTemplates->primary_industry,
- 'deputy_industry' => $wechatTemplatesMsg->wechatTemplates->wechatPublicTemplates->deputy_industry,
- 'content' => $wechatTemplatesMsg->wechatTemplates->wechatPublicTemplates->content,
- 'example' => $wechatTemplatesMsg->wechatTemplates->wechatPublicTemplates->example,
- 'subscribe_time' => $wechatTemplatesMsg->subscribe_time,
- 'sex' => $wechatTemplatesMsg->sex,
- 'balance' => $wechatTemplatesMsg->balance,
- 'order_type' => $wechatTemplatesMsg->order_type,
- 'category_id' => $wechatTemplatesMsg->category_id,
- 'is_full_send' => $wechatTemplatesMsg->is_full_send,
- 'user_num' => $wechatTemplatesMsg->user_num,
- 'is_activity' => isset($wechatTemplatesMsg->is_activity)?$wechatTemplatesMsg->is_activity:'0',
- 'user_category' => isset($wechatTemplatesMsg->user_category)?$wechatTemplatesMsg->user_category:'',
- 'uv' => isset($wechatTemplatesMsg->uv)?$wechatTemplatesMsg->uv:'',
- 'pv' => isset($wechatTemplatesMsg->pv)?$wechatTemplatesMsg->pv:'',
- 'register_user_num' => isset($wechatTemplatesMsg->register_user_num)?$wechatTemplatesMsg->register_user_num:'',
- 'pay_user_num' => isset($wechatTemplatesMsg->pay_user_num)?$wechatTemplatesMsg->pay_user_num:'',
- 'charge_amount' => isset($wechatTemplatesMsg->charge_amount)?$wechatTemplatesMsg->charge_amount:'',
- 'book_name' => isset($wechatTemplatesMsg->book_name)?$wechatTemplatesMsg->book_name:'',
- 'chapter_name' => isset($wechatTemplatesMsg->chapter_name)?$wechatTemplatesMsg->chapter_name:'',
- ];
- }
- }
|